Government & DOD 8140 Training / Certification Bootcamps
The DoD 8140 Directive is also known as the Information Assurance Workforce Improvement Program. The Department of Defense passed a regulation stating that all Information Assurance personnel must become compliant with the mandated IT and Security certification standards within a certain time frame. There are various levels of compliance based on the level of job function. The most common certifications included in the DoD Directive 8570.01 include A+, Network+, Security+, CEH and CISSP.
In addition to the baseline IA certification requirement for their level listed above the DoD 8140 mandate states IATs with privileged access must obtain appropriate Computing Environment (CE) certifications for the operating system(s) and/or security related tools/devices they support as required by their employing organization. (e. g. Microsoft certification for Microsoft systems support technicians, Cisco certifications for Cisco technicians or the specific system the IAT is spending most of his or her time supporting) This requirement ensures they can effectively apply IA requirements to their hardware and software systems.
